What you will do: - Set the field marketing strategy across multiple territories, aligning event investment with pipeline and revenue targets and building the frameworks the broader team uses to plan and execute. - Own the full event lifecycle at a program and portfolio level, from strategy and planning through execution and post-event analysis, across virtual and in-person experiences. - Partner directly with sales, marketing, and executive leadership to select, prioritize, and optimize the event portfolio, ensuring every program earns its place on the calendar. - Own budget and pipeline targets across multiple regions, driving lead generation and revenue impact through disciplined forecasting, tracking, and optimization. - Build and manage vendor and agency relationships at scale, negotiating contracts and setting the standard for cost efficiency and execution quality across all programs. - Mentor and provide guidance to field marketers and coordinators, raising the bar for execution and building bench strength on the team. - Report on portfolio performance to executive leadership, translating data into clear recommendations that shape future investment. - Build the measurement frameworks and reporting cadence that let the company evaluate event ROI consistently, in partnership with analytics and operations. - Champion best practices across field marketing, setting the standard for execution, experience quality, and accountability company-wide. Requirements: - 10+ years of B2B event and field marketing experience across in-person and virtual programs, including experience running a portfolio across multiple territories or regions. - A track record of partnering with sales leadership, not just sales teams, to shape territory strategy and accelerate pipeline creation. - Experience managing or mentoring other marketers, with the ability to build team capability alongside personal execution. - A data-driven mindset with deep experience analyzing event performance and building measurement frameworks using CRM and marketing automation tools. - A strong ownership mindset with accountability for results across a multi-region field marketing program. - Ability to manage a large portfolio of programs, vendors, and stakeholders in a fast-paced, high-growth environment. - Excellent executive communication skills, with the ability to distill performance data into insights and recommendations for senior leadership. - Experience marketing to technical or security audiences is a plus. - Based in the time zone of your territory. - Willingness to travel 30 to 40 percent as required to support regional events. - Location: The greater Chicago area - Office Structure: Hybrid/Remote - Region: Great Lakes & Canada At Zafran, people matter! If you’re curious, fun, and someone who gets things done, we’d love to meet you ## APPLY FOR THIS POSITION ## About Zafran Security ## Company Overview - **One-liner**: Zafran Security provides an AI-native Threat Exposure Management platform that unifies vulnerability data, assesses exploitability in context, and automates mitigation and remediation using existing security controls. - **Entity Type**: Private (Series C) - **Headquarters**: New York, New York, United States [linkedin.com] - **Founded**: 2023 (inferred from initial seed funding in early 2024) [linkedin.com] - **Founders**: Sanaz Yashar (CEO) and Ben Seri (CTO) [zafran.io/about] ## Core Business - **Primary industry**: Cybersecurity (vulnerability / exposure management) - **Target customers**: Enterprise security teams (Fortune 500 and high-growth companies) [zafran.io/platform] - **Mission or purpose statement**: “Proactively stop the exploitation of vulnerabilities, everywhere.” [zafran.io/about] ## Products & Services - **Zafran Threat Exposure Management Platform** (SaaS / agentic): End-to-end platform that unifies findings across cloud, on-prem, and AppSec; assesses risk using runtime presence, reachability, exploitability, asset criticality, and existing controls; enables proactive exposure hunting; provides mitigation guidance that leverages compensating controls; and automates remediation via RemOps (generative AI‑powered remediation operations). [zafran.io/platform] - **Zafran Detector** (released Aug 2025): Continuous vulnerability discovery tool that supplements existing scanners. [linkedin.com] - **Agentic Remediation™**: AI agents that research CVE conditions, validate exploitability on live assets, generate remediation scripts, and maintain human oversight with approval workflows. [zafran.io/platform] ## Market Standing - **Valuation/Market Cap**: Not disclosed (private company) - **Key Metric**: Total funding of $105.5M as of December 2025. Breakdown: Seed $5.5M (Mar 2024), Series B $40M (Sep 2024, led by Sequoia Capital and Cyberstarts), Series C $60M (Dec 2025, led by Menlo Ventures). [linkedin.com] - **Notable Investors/Partners**: Sequoia Capital (Doug Leone on board), Cyberstarts (Lior Simon on board), Menlo Ventures (Rama Sekhar on board), Amex Ventures (strategic investor in 2026). Included in Microsoft for Startups Pegasus Program. [zafran.io/about, linkedin.com] - **Growth Signals**: 132 employees (51% YoY growth, +58 people); 30 open positions as of mid‑2026; monthly job postings up 57.9% YoY; expansion across US, Israel, Germany, and UK. [linkedin.com] ## Competitive Advantages - **AI-native, context-aware analysis**: Applies each customer’s unique asset criticality, runtime presence, and existing control stack to determine which vulnerabilities are truly exploitable – eliminating up to 90% of critical false positives. [zafran.io/platform] - **Leverages existing defenses**: Rather than demanding new agents or patch‑only fixes, Zafran maps exposures to compensating controls and provides step‑by‑step mitigation guidance, shrinking exposure windows before patching begins. [zafran.io/platform] - **Closed‑loop automation**: Agentic Remediation and RemOps reduce manual triage, consolidate overlapping CVEs into single remediation actions, and route work automatically via ticketing integrations. [zafran.io/platform] - **Founding team with breach‑response experience**: Co‑founders directly investigated breaches resulting from known vulnerabilities, giving the product a practitioner‑driven design.
